Should We Feel Sorry for Olympic Press Chief Kevan Gosper?
http://www.teachabroadchina.com/2008-olympic-games-gosper-censorship/ ^

Posted on 08/02/2008 3:58:04 AM PDT by robertvance

While I wish I could feel sorry for Gosper, there is just one problem. Every time he opens his mouth, he seems to be defending or at least speaking for the Chinese government. Yesterday, for example, in response to criticism about the Internet censorship he said "that we are not working in a democratic society, we’re working in a communist society." He continued by stating that "this is China, and they are proud to be a communist society." Really? Did the IOC not know that China was a proud "communist society" when it bestowed the Olympics upon Beijing eight years ago or is this another surprise? Let me guess. China also promised the IOC that it would become "a democratic society" just in time for the Olympic Games, right? Forget about China being a proud communist society. Mr Gosper and the IOC are apparently proud to be associated with the Chinese Communist Party. After all, they are defending the Chinese government’s censorship policies much better than the CCP ever could have dreamed of doing itself.
